Mount Juliet, affectionately referred to as “MJ,” is a tranquil suburb situated about 18 miles east of Downtown Nashville. Mount Juliet continues to attract new residents with its peaceful atmosphere, great schools, small-town feel, ample recreational opportunities, and many suburban conveniences.
MJ is home to Providence Marketplace, the largest shopping complex between Nashville and Knoxville, touting hundreds of shops and restaurants for the community to enjoy. Mount Juliet is convenient to a broad range of outdoor recreation at Charlie Daniels Park, Windtree Golf Club, and the numerous parks surrounding the Cumberland River and J. Percy Priest Reservoir.
Mount Juliet is also just a short drive away from major attractions like the Hermitage Farm and the Grand Ole Opry. Commuting and traveling from MJ is a breeze with access to U.S. 70 and I-40 as well as the Nashville International Airport.
